Onondaga Men's Tennis defeated SUNY Broome, 8-1, on Wednesday afternoon at Anthony J. Santaro Park. The Lazers were led by four double-winners,
Fabrizio Tucci,
Sacha Borel,
Eric Day, and
Ryan Charlebois.

Fabrizio Tucci defeated Ben Gonzalez 6-1 in the first set of first singles, and narrowly took the second set 6-4.
Sacha Borel made quick work of his opponent in second-singles, winning 6-0 in both sets. Tucci and Borel teamed up in first-doubles and shutout their opponents 8-0.

Eric Day took down his opponent 6-1 in both sets of third-singles, and
Ryan Charlebois dominated his matchup 6-1 and 6-0. Day and Charlebois competed in second-doubles together. The duo took a quick 5-0 lead before Broome began their comeback. The Hornets were able to cut the lead to 7-4, but Day and Charlebois were able to close out the match for the win.

Hunter Mazuroski had an early 3-0 advantage in the first set when Sidney Snpad fought back to narrow Mazuroski's lead to 4-3. Mazuroski then found his stroke, keeping Snpad scoreless through the rest of the first set and commanding the second set 6-1.
Matt Copani went point-for-point through two sets of his matchup in sixth-singles, taking the first set 6-4 and losing the second 6-4. Copani then ruled the tie-breaking third set, 10-4, for the Lazers to sweep singles. Mazuroski and Copani wrapped up the day in third-doubles, losing the suspenseful matchup 9-8.
